The Importance of Enterprise Storage

Enterprise storage technology is a critical component of modern IT infrastructure. It impacts everything from data security to operational efficiency. But calculating its business value can be challenging due to the diverse factors involved.

The Role of Enterprise Storage

Enterprise storage systems are designed to handle large volumes of data securely and efficiently. They provide fast data access, robust disaster recovery capabilities, and high availability. With the increasing amount of data generated by businesses, effective storage solutions are more important than ever, as noted in Fortune Business Insights' healthcare data storage market report.

Calculating the Business Value

Understanding the business value of enterprise storage involves several key metrics and calculations. Here’s how to approach this complex task.

Cost-Benefit Analysis

To calculate the business value, start with a cost-benefit analysis. Consider both the tangible and intangible benefits:

  • Initial Investment: Hardware, software, and implementation costs, as outlined in Blocks and Files' storage news ticker.
  • Operational Costs: Maintenance, energy consumption, and staff training are critical components of total cost of ownership.
  • Intangible Benefits: Improved customer satisfaction and employee productivity, which are often overlooked but crucial for long-term success.

Real-World Use Cases

Enterprise storage technology has transformed various industries. Here are a few examples:

Healthcare

In healthcare, patient data must be accessible yet secure. Enterprise storage solutions enable hospitals to store large volumes of data while ensuring compliance with regulations like HIPAA, as noted in Fortune Business Insights' healthcare data storage market report.

Finance

Financial institutions deal with massive amounts of transactional data. Advanced storage solutions provide the speed and reliability needed to process transactions efficiently, a necessity highlighted in Fortune Business Insights' data center market report.

Retail

Retailers use enterprise storage to manage inventory data, customer information, and sales records, improving customer service and operational efficiency, as discussed in Foxit's document management system launch.

Future Trends in Enterprise Storage

The enterprise storage landscape is evolving rapidly. Here are a few trends to watch:

NVMe Adoption

Non-Volatile Memory Express (NVMe) is transforming storage with faster data access speeds. Expect more enterprises to adopt NVMe-enabled solutions, as discussed in TechTarget.

Cloud Integration

Hybrid cloud solutions are becoming standard, offering flexibility and scalability. Cloud integration allows businesses to leverage both on-premises and cloud storage, a trend highlighted in Cloudwards' disaster recovery guide.

AI and Machine Learning

AI and machine learning are enhancing storage management by automating routine tasks and optimizing storage usage, as noted in Oracle's blog.
